Simplifying 2(7 + -8x) = -30 + -2x (7 * 2 + -8x * 2) = -30 + -2x (14 + -16x) = -30 + -2x Solving 14 + -16x = -30 + -2x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2x' to each side of the equation. 14 + -16x + 2x = -30 + -2x + 2x Combine like terms: -16x + 2x = -14x 14 + -14x = -30 + -2x + 2x Combine like terms: -2x + 2x = 0 14 + -14x = -30 + 0 14 + -14x = -30 Add '-14' to each side of the equation. 14 + -14 + -14x = -30 + -14 Combine like terms: 14 + -14 = 0 0 + -14x = -30 + -14 -14x = -30 + -14 Combine like terms: -30 + -14 = -44 -14x = -44 Divide each side by '-14'. x = 3.142857143 Simplifying x = 3.142857143
